PHPackages                             topphp/topphp-consul - PHPackages - PHPackages  [Skip to content](#main-content)[PHPackages](/)[Directory](/)[Categories](/categories)[Trending](/trending)[Leaderboard](/leaderboard)[Changelog](/changelog)[Analyze](/analyze)[Collections](/collections)[Log in](/login)[Sign up](/register)

1. [Directory](/)
2. /
3. topphp/topphp-consul

ActiveLibrary

topphp/topphp-consul
====================

服务中心客户端组件

v1.0.1(6y ago)04011MITPHPPHP ~7.2

Since Mar 8Pushed 6y ago1 watchersCompare

[ Source](https://github.com/topphp/topphp-consul)[ Packagist](https://packagist.org/packages/topphp/topphp-consul)[ RSS](/packages/topphp-topphp-consul/feed)WikiDiscussions master Synced today

READMEChangelog (2)Dependencies (5)Versions (3)Used By (1)

topphp-consul
=============

[](#topphp-consul)

[![Latest Version on Packagist](https://camo.githubusercontent.com/b2451ab3581f73eb19042f68ac4b635f9e1fcaf4402e7b006985db3c3f76dcec/68747470733a2f2f696d672e736869656c64732e696f2f7061636b61676973742f762f746f707068702f746f707068702d636f6e73756c2e7376673f7374796c653d666c61742d737175617265)](https://packagist.org/packages/topphp/topphp-consul)[![Software License](https://camo.githubusercontent.com/55c0218c8f8009f06ad4ddae837ddd05301481fcf0dff8e0ed9dadda8780713e/68747470733a2f2f696d672e736869656c64732e696f2f62616467652f6c6963656e73652d4d49542d627269676874677265656e2e7376673f7374796c653d666c61742d737175617265)](LICENSE.md)[![Build Status](https://camo.githubusercontent.com/2b0bea4db705fd8f19d46c142a29f041401d700e4f5eb7f1774e7e3f6cf5c5b3/68747470733a2f2f696d672e736869656c64732e696f2f7472617669732f746f707068702f746f707068702d636f6e73756c2f6d61737465722e7376673f7374796c653d666c61742d737175617265)](https://travis-ci.org/topphp/topphp-consul)[![Coverage Status](https://camo.githubusercontent.com/dc607f79bfd0c27df84116845ede0d43e4e76a70a5a75288a8324e0c2e859106/68747470733a2f2f696d672e736869656c64732e696f2f7363727574696e697a65722f636f7665726167652f672f746f707068702f746f707068702d636f6e73756c2e7376673f7374796c653d666c61742d737175617265)](https://scrutinizer-ci.com/g/topphp/topphp-consul/code-structure)[![Quality Score](https://camo.githubusercontent.com/f2f6098c118bbab572a179e941b31d34bff6d7c4ce21fe0844fd705f5e44a5ef/68747470733a2f2f696d672e736869656c64732e696f2f7363727574696e697a65722f672f746f707068702f746f707068702d636f6e73756c2e7376673f7374796c653d666c61742d737175617265)](https://scrutinizer-ci.com/g/topphp/topphp-consul)[![Total Downloads](https://camo.githubusercontent.com/a543e6e7075e0cea959dcce2db23cc44a1e3b7ced9df79653bf3ea6c564771b4/68747470733a2f2f696d672e736869656c64732e696f2f7061636b61676973742f64742f746f707068702f746f707068702d636f6e73756c2e7376673f7374796c653d666c61742d737175617265)](https://packagist.org/packages/topphp/topphp-consul)

\#服务中心客户端

> topphp提供了一个consul组件,基于 `topphp/topphp-client` 提供的`http` 客户端进行的封装,依赖于`thinkphp6`。 topphp-swoole 组件已经内置该组件

#### 单独安装

[](#单独安装)

```
# 运行以下命令
$ composer require topphp/topphp-consul
```

#### 配置

[](#配置)

> 配置文件 `config/consul.php`

```
